The Founding of an Army [Audio: China]
Description
Following in the footsteps of 2009's The Founding of a Republic and 2011's The Founding of a Party comes the all-star Chinese historical drama The Founding of an Army, produced to commemorate the 90th anniversary of the founding of the People's Liberation Army. Hong Kong director Andrew Lau (Infernal Affairs) takes the reins for this massive cinematic undertaking set in 1927 during the breakout of the Chinese Civil War between the Communists and the Nationalists. The film follows the strategic and organizational efforts of Zhou Enlai, Mao Zedong and other key figures leading up to war, and depicts important military engagements, including the Nanchang Uprising and the Sanheba Battle in Guangdong, in impressively extensive and explosive war action scenes.
